Transaction ddfdce60b8554d10dee6bac75b79388f1f5e5876fc88f3c0f3b21781f40965b0
1 Input
1 Output
-
ddfdce60b8554d10dee6bac75b79388f1f5e5876fc88f3c0f3b21781f40965b0:0
- value
- 26392717
- script pubkey
- OP_0 OP_PUSHBYTES_20 3808a317d57b72ffd0a15bdd6d3108f9095c391a
- address
- bc1q8qy2x9740de0l59pt0wk6vgglyy4cwg67rgfa6